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6596 47 06937186 274
0931 193082 568312861
0931 193082 568312861
3193609 76254452503 565547
All about undefined
Interested in learning more?
0931 193082 568312861
3193609 76254452503 565547
See more
37486252696 46 20037273
564 900081 304064 80597936 67
See more
15518349 63357295
0731 4898 56961570 961 278
See more